The American Airlines Center will be the scene on Thursday night for Game Six between the Phoenix Suns and the Dallas Mavericks. The top-seeded Suns won a league best 32 road games during the regular season and lead the postseason in offensive efficiency. On Tuesday, Phoenix outscored Dallas by 19 points during the third quarter to pull away for a 110-80 home victory.

All-Star G Devin Booker matched a game-high with 28 points on 11-for-20 shooting and pulled down seven boards. Deandre Ayton contributed 20 points and nine rebounds for the Suns.

The Dallas Mavericks won 29 of their 41 home games during the regular season and 4-1 at home this postseason. During the Game Five loss, Dallas was limited to 34 points during the second half and were outrebounded by a 50-38 margin. The fourth-seeded Mavericks missed 24 of their 32 three-point attempts and shot just 38 percent overall.

All-Star G Luka Doncic led Dallas with 28 points on 10-for-23 shooting and grabbed 11 rebounds. The rest of the starters combined for just 29 points on 11-for-28 from the field.

Dallas F Reggie Bullock suffered a left knee injury on Tuesday and is expected to play in this game. These two teams rank in the bottom three this postseason in pace, so the under is worth a look.
